Output 58470910ba3339d9a93a8053e7687f737cfbaa96eb78a5489d40ae6af77b2b94:0

value
2240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908fa7693399dddacc99c16de11c77ac83229ae4 OP_EQUAL
address
3EsPKREjqBAL8xgVgJKLB9bA1FYTjDUFay
transaction
58470910ba3339d9a93a8053e7687f737cfbaa96eb78a5489d40ae6af77b2b94